In Curtis, AR, FMCSA rules dictate that transportation employees undergo routine drug and alcohol tests to uphold safety standards.
FMCSA regulations in Curtis, Arkansas are critical in maintaining road safety through stringent drug/alcohol testing protocols for drivers.
USCG regulations in Curtis, AR necessitate drug/alcohol testing for maritime personnel to preserve safety in navigable waters.
In Curtis, Arkansas, USCG enforces mandatory screenings, significantly contributing to maritime operational safety and discipline.
FAA regulations in Curtis, AR require aviation personnel to undergo rigorous drug and alcohol testing to maintain air traffic safety standards.
In Curtis, Arkansas, FAA enforces comprehensive drug/alcohol testing to assure public trust in aviation safety and reliability.
FRA rules in Curtis, AR mandate intense drug/alcohol testing for rail employees to enhance safety measures across the rail network.
Through stringent FRA mandates, Curtis, Arkansas ensures railway operations are conducted under safe, drug-free conditions.
FTA guidelines in Curtis, AR require transit employees to engage in regular screenings to reinforce drug/alcohol compliance and passenger safety.
In Curtis, Arkansas, FTA testing rules are pivotal in sustaining safe transit environments, ensuring consistent employee monitoring.
PHMSA in Curtis, AR enforces regular screenings for pipeline operators to ensure drug/alcohol compliance and safety adherence.
Ensuring a safe operational environment in Curtis, Arkansas, PHMSA mandates strict drug and alcohol testing among safety-critical roles.

Curtis, AR DUI Statistics
In Curtis, Arkansas, located in Clark County, Driving Under the Influence (DUI) remains a significant concern for the Department of Transportation (DOT). Despite efforts by law enforcement agencies and awareness campaigns, DUI incidents continue to affect road safety in the area. Arkansas has stringent laws concerning DUI, with penalties increasing substantially for repeat offenders. According to state data, Clark County, which encompasses Curtis, has seen an uptick in alcohol-related offenses, reflecting broader state trends. Increasing enforcement and public awareness are part of a concerted effort by DOT and local authorities to combat this issue. The implications of DUI are far-reaching, affecting not only the lives of those involved but also putting a strain on local emergency services and the judicial system.
